在 SQL 中,ROW_NUMBER() 函數用于為結果集中的行分配一個唯一的數字。它通常與 ORDER BY 子句一起使用,以在結果集中為行分配順序號。
ROW_NUMBER() 的主要用途之一是對結果集中的行進行排序,并分配順序號。這使得可以輕松地對結果進行分頁,或者篩選出一定范圍的行。
另一個常見的用途是在查詢結果中標識出重復的行。通過使用 ROW_NUMBER() 函數,可以為重復的行分配相同的順序號,從而方便進行進一步的處理或篩選。
總的來說,ROW_NUMBER() 函數為結果集中的行分配唯一的順序號,方便進行排序、分頁和識別重復行等操作。